The default value is 0.375. */ extern const MGLShapeSourceOption MGLShapeSourceOptionSimplificationTolerance; /** `MGLShapeSource` is a map content source that supplies vector shapes to be shown on the map. The shapes may be instances of `MGLShape` or `MGLFeature`, or they may be defined by local or external GeoJSON code. A shape source is added to an `MGLStyle` object along with an `MGLVectorStyleLayer` object. The vector style layer defines the appearance of any content supplied by the shape source. Each geojson source defined by the style JSON file is represented at runtime by an `MGLShapeSource` object that you can use to refine the map’s content and initialize new style layers. You can also add and remove sources dynamically using methods such as `-[MGLStyle addSource:]` and `-[MGLStyle sourceWithIdentifier:]`. Any vector style layer initialized with a shape source should have a `nil` value in its `sourceLayerIdentifier` property. */ @interface MGLShapeSource : MGLSource #pragma mark Initializing a Source /** Returns a shape source with an identifier, URL, and dictionary of options for the source. @param identifier A string that uniquely identifies the source. @param URL An HTTP(S) URL, absolute file URL, or local file URL relative to the current application’s resource bundle. @param options An `NSDictionary` of options for this source. @return An initialized shape source. */ - (instancetype)initWithIdentifier:(NSString *)identifier URL:(NSURL *)url options:(nullable NS_DICTIONARY_OF(MGLShapeSourceOption, id) *)options NS_DESIGNATED_INITIALIZER; /** Returns a shape source with an identifier, a shape, and dictionary of options for the source.
